The Role of the Interstate Medical Licensure Compact (IMLC)
The most considerable contributor to the "instant" licensing motion is the Interstate Medical Licensure Compact (IMLC). The IMLC is an agreement among getting involved U.S. states and territories to interact to considerably improve the licensing process for physicians who desire to practice in several states.

Under this compact, a physician can acquire a Letter of Qualification (LOQ) from their state of principal licensure. Once this letter is released, Günstige Medizinische Approbation Online the physician can "purchase" or request licenses from any other member state nearly instantly.

Is it legal to "buy" a medical license?
It is legal to pay administrative costs for expedited processing through main state boards or the IMLC. However, it is extremely prohibited to buy a deceptive license or medical diploma from a non-accredited source.
2. How quickly can I in fact get a license through the IMLC?
As soon as the Letter of Qualification is released (which takes 2-- 4 weeks), additional state licenses can frequently be approved within 3 to 5 service days.
3. Do all states get involved in expedited licensing?
The majority of states have some form of expedited pathway for "clean" applications, but only those in the IMLC (presently over 35 states and areas) provide the true expedited multi-state procedure.
4. What is the distinction in between a "Temporary License" and an "Expedited License"?
A short-lived license is normally provided throughout public health emergency situations or for specific short-term roles and may expire rapidly. An expedited license is a complete, irreversible medical license provided through a quicker administrative process.
5. Does an expedited license have restricted privileges?
No. An expedited license given through the IMLC or a state's fast-track program brings the exact same weight, rights, and responsibilities as a license obtained through the standard path.
